# --------------------------------
# GCC option checking
# --------------------------------

cc-option = $(shell if $(CC) $(CFLAGS) $(1) -S -o /dev/null -xc /dev/null \
             > /dev/null 2>&1; then echo "$(1)"; else echo "$(2)"; fi ;)

# ---------------------------------------------------------------------------
# Build commands
# ---------------------------------------------------------------------------

# To make warnings more obvious, be less verbose as default
# Use 'make V=1' to see the full commands
ifdef V
  quiet =
else
  quiet = quiet_
endif

quiet_cmd_mkdir = '  MKDIR    $(@D)'
      cmd_mkdir = mkdir -p $(@D)

define do_mkdir
	@if [ ! -d $(@D) ]; then \
		echo $($(quiet)cmd_mkdir); \
		$(cmd_mkdir); \
	fi;
endef

quiet_cmd_cp = '  CP       $@'
      cmd_cp = cp $< $@

define do_cp
	$(do_mkdir)
	@echo $($(quiet)cmd_cp)
	@$(cmd_cp)
endef

# cmd_fixdep => Turn all pre-requisites into targets with no commands, to
# prevent errors when moving files around between builds (e.g. from NQ or QW
# dirs to the common dir.)
cmd_fixdep = \
	cp $(@D)/.$(@F).d $(@D)/.$(@F).d.tmp && \
	sed -e 's/\#.*//' -e 's/^[^:]*: *//' -e 's/ *\\$$//' -e '/^$$/ d' \
	    -e 's/$$/ :/' < $(@D)/.$(@F).d.tmp >> $(@D)/.$(@F).d && \
	rm -f $(@D)/.$(@F).d.tmp && \
	if grep -q TYRUTILS_VERSION $<; then \
		printf '%s: %s\n' $@ $(BUILD_VER) >> $(@D)/.$(@F).d ; \
	fi

cmd_cc_dep_c = \
	$(CC) -MM -MT $@ $(CPPFLAGS) -o $(@D)/.$(@F).d $< ; \
	$(cmd_fixdep)
